检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
时,经常要调用后台数据,例如购物车中用户的ID,订单编号,商品信息等,这时需要通过桥接器动态调用后台接口获取后台数据。通过华为云Astro大屏应用预置的桥接器模板,您可以自定义桥接器。自定义桥接器时,需要先下载桥接器模板,根据组件的数据结构,对桥接数据进行对接和改造。如何自定义桥接器,请参见自定义桥接器。
在项目列表中,单击页面所在的项目,进入项目。 将鼠标放在待复制的页面上,单击。 在弹出的提示框中,单击“确定”。 输入页面标题,单击“新建”。 复制成功后,系统自动进入开发页面。 图1 输入页面标题 父主题: 页面管理
label Object 否 label: { "zh_CN": "中文标签", "en_US": "En label" } 配置项的标签,需要国际化。 tip Object 否 tip: { zh_CN: "中文提示", en_US: "English tip"} 提示图标,当配置项比较复杂,可以添加一些提示内容。
ftl 文件介绍 {widget}.html为组件DOM结构文件,相当于HTML文件,负责样式展示。 在华为云Astro大屏应用中自定义组件时,需要在服务端提前渲染的部分,可以写在此文件中。 文件示例 <div id="EchartsWidgetTemplate" v-cloak>
购买华为云Astro大屏应用实例 在使用华为云Astro大屏应用前,您需要购买一个华为云Astro大屏应用实例。华为云Astro大屏应用实例是一个独立的资源空间,所有的操作都是在实例内进行,不同实例间的资源相互隔离。 华为云Astro大屏应用提供了“华为云Astro大屏应用基础版
户,实现多人协助开发可视化大屏应用。 前提条件 已参考创建IAM用户中操作,创建IAM用户。默认情况下,新创建的IAM用户没有任何权限。您需要为其授予权限,或将其加入用户组,并给用户组授权,用户组中的用户将获得用户组的权限。创建用户组时,请给用户组赋予“Astro Canvas
创建分组 用户可以创建分组,并将多个组件放到一个组中。创建分组后,可对该组中的所有组件进行整体复制、删除、移动等操作。若需要解除分组,单击右键选择“解除分组”即可。 创建分组 参考登录华为云Astro大屏应用界面中操作,登录华为云Astro大屏应用界面。 在页面编辑模式下,选中所需的组件,单击右键选择“创建分组”。
在编辑页面状态下,选中组件,单击右键,选择“重命名”。 图1 重命名 您也可以在“图层”中,将鼠标悬浮在组件上,单击“重命名”。 图2 在图层中重命名组件 在输入框中,输入组件的新名称。 父主题: 组件管理
应用界面。 在项目列表页面,单击右上角的“+ 新建项目”。 选择“移动端”,输入项目名称为“Alarm”,单击“新建”。 图2 新建移动端项目 在项目中,单击“+新建页面”。 单击“新建空白页面”,输入页面标题“告警处理情况统计”,单击“新建”。 设置水平基本柱图组件。 在左侧全
editor.js文件中定义的type字段,来定义组件的类型和配置。 表1 配置项总览 类别 类型 说明 输入框 input 单行文本输入框 textarea 多行文本输入框 数字类型 input-number 计数器 slider 滑块 切换类型 tab 切换 switch 开关
stro大屏应用界面。 在编辑页面状态下,选择“数据”,单击“+”。 输入页面数据集的名称,单击“确定”。 在新建页面数据集页面,拖入一个数据输入节点,并选择数据源。 从“数据转换”中,拖拽一个转换器节点到输入节点后,此时页面会出现一个图标。 单击图标,即可进入盘古助手。 图2 在页面数据集中调出盘古助手
代码优化 参考新建转换器中操作,新建一个转换器。 在“测试数据”中,选择所需的数据源。 在“function filter(dataset)”中,输入转换器的数据处理代码。 在页面右下方单击,进入盘古助手。 在盘古助手中,单击“快捷指令”,选择“代码优化”。 图1 选择代码优化 盘古助手会对当前转换器中的代码进行优化。
入门实践 当您购买了华为云Astro大屏应用实例后,可以根据业务需要搭建所需的大屏页面和移动端页面。本文介绍华为云Astro大屏应用常见的搭建实践,帮助您更好的使用华为云Astro大屏应用。 表1 常用最佳实践 实践 描述 使用华为云Astro大屏应用开发人员来访统计大屏页面 本
getConnectorProperties(); // 获取组件Connector数据 // 监听resize事件, 画布resize时需要重新绘制一下,如果有其他需要,参数可以传入函数,resize时会调用 this.registerResizeEvent(); }, getConnectorProperties
在主菜单中,选择“数据中心”。 在左侧导航栏中,选择“数据集 > 全部”。 单击“所有数据集”,再单击“...”,选择“新增目录”。 在新增目录页面,输入目录的名称,单击“确定”。 名称的长度为1~64个字符,可包括中文、字母、数字及下划线,且不能以下划线开头或结尾。 图1 新建一个目录 确
场景地址:设置渲染的3D场景地址。 选择场景:单击“选择场景”,可以在“场景”中新建场景或选择已有场景,也可以从“案例库”中选择场景。 输入场景URL:直接输入图观的二次开发场景地址。 交互 在交互中,设置图观端场景编辑器与其他组件或页面之间的交互能力。更多交互介绍,请参见交互设置。 父主题:
的功能。 配置数据集参数。 图2 ROMA连接器配置示例 API接口:API请求路径。 请求类型:请求的类型,如GET、POST。 参数:输入参数,请根据实际请求进行配置。 测试API接口:用于测试该接口,单击“测试API接口”,“样例报文”中会显示输出结果。 样例报文:对应AP
前缀:是否显示前缀,设置为“显示”时,支持设置如下属性。 前缀内容:输入数值前缀的内容。 前缀字体:设置数值前缀的字体、大小和颜色等。 右间距:设置前缀和数值之间的间距。 后缀:是否显示后缀,设置为“显示”时,支持设置如下属性。 后缀内容:输入数值后缀的内容。 后缀字体:设置数值后缀的字体、大小和颜色等。
开发页面。 在工具栏中,单击,进入页面发布设置。 在“版本管理”区域,单击需要回退版本后的,单击“继续编辑”,进行回退。 如果回退前希望保存当前页面,请单击“发布新版本”,将当前页面发布为新版本,再单击需要回退版本后的,单击“继续编辑”,进行回退。 图1 回退到历史版本 图2 提示
图2)的距离,默认为0,即铺满整个组件。 配置 在配置中,可对文本的内容进行设置,如输入具体内容、设置内容字体、大小和颜色等。 图4 标题配置 文本设置 文本内容:设置文本内容。 字体:设置输入文本内容的字体、大小和颜色等。 文字间距:设置文字之间的距离。 对齐方式:设置文本内容对齐方式,支持左对齐、居中和右对齐。